Overnight Restaurant information

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Overnight Restaurant Worker, and why are they important?

To succeed as an Overnight Restaurant Worker, you need experience in food preparation, basic culinary skills, knowledge of food safety regulations, and often a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, kitchen appliances, and health certification (such as a food handler’s card) is typically required. Strong teamwork, attention to detail, and the ability to remain alert and personable during late hours are crucial soft skills. These abilities ensure efficient operations, customer satisfaction, and compliance with safety standards during overnight shifts.

What are some common challenges faced by overnight restaurant staff, and how can they be managed effectively?

Overnight restaurant staff often encounter challenges such as lower staffing levels, managing late-night customer behavior, and staying alert during non-traditional hours. It's important to develop strong communication skills to handle customer concerns tactfully and to work collaboratively with a smaller team. Adhering to safety protocols and maintaining a clean, organized workspace can help ensure a smooth shift. Additionally, finding ways to manage energy and practice self-care, such as taking short breaks when possible, can help staff remain focused and motivated throughout the night.

What are Overnight Restaurant workers?

Overnight restaurant workers are employees who work during the late-night or early-morning hours, typically when most other staff are off-duty. Their responsibilities often include preparing food, cleaning the restaurant, restocking supplies, and serving any late-night customers. These workers ensure that the restaurant operates smoothly and remains clean and ready for business the next day. Overnight shifts are common in 24-hour diners, fast food restaurants, and establishments that provide late-night services.
